ENGINEERINGNET.EU -- The Belgian Connect Group recently completed the IRIS certification process for its Czech facility.

IRIS, short for ‘International Railway Industry Standard’, complies with the specific requirements of the ISO 9001 international quality standard for the rail industry.

The certificate is intented to make relationships between suppliers and manufacturers more transparent by stating uniform rules to be observed by all suppliers.

For Connect, the certification tops several investments strengthening the performance of the company.

Among others, the group recently invested in a state of the art coating line to prevent manual touch-up. Furthermore, specific machinery was implemented to optimize component preparation.

The investment program will be continued with automated visual inspections and ongoing training activities, states the company.

Luc Switten, CEO of the group: “I strongly believe that the internationally accepted certification of IRIS will increase our credit of a respected and reliable supplier for the railway market and will contribute to a stronger growth in this market.”


BACKGROUNDER
Connect Group focuses on specific markets such as Railway, Health Care and semiconductors. The Belgium based company employs over 1.800 people and is present in 5 different European countries. Connect Group’s references include Alstom, Faiveley, GSP Sprachtechnologie, Skoda Electric, Unicontrols and Trapeze.
